How Can I Increase My Chances of Getting SSDI in Nebraska?

Getting approved for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I) benefits in Nebraska can be challenging. It's essential to understand the steps involved and how to increase your chances of success. Below are key strategies to help improve your chances of receiving SSDI benefits.


Key things to know about increasing your chances of SSDI approval in Nebraska


  • Provide Complete Medical Evidence – One of the most important factors in SSDI approval is the medical evidence supporting your disability. Ensure you submit complete, up-to-date medical records, including doctor’s notes, test results, and treatment history, to show the severity of your condition.
  • Document Your Disability's Impact on Your Life – SSDI isn’t just about having a medical condition; it's about proving that the condition significantly limits your ability to work. Keep a detailed record of how your disability affects your daily activities and job performance.
  • Follow Your Doctor’s Treatment Plan – The SSA looks favorably on applicants who are actively following a treatment plan for their condition. Consistently attend medical appointments and adhere to prescribed treatments to demonstrate your commitment to improving your health.
  • Work History and Earnings Records – SSDI eligibility is based partly on your work history and earnings. Ensure that the SSA has accurate records of your past employment and that you meet the necessary work credits to qualify for benefits.
  • Consider Hiring an SSDI Attorney – Navigating the SSDI process can be complicated, and many initial claims are denied. An experienced SSDI attorney can help you gather the necessary documentation, submit your claim correctly, and represent you in the appeals process if needed.
  • Avoid Gaps in Your Application – Submit your application and any necessary forms promptly. Delays in submitting paperwork can cause your claim to be delayed or rejected.
  • Stay Persistent After a Denial – If your initial SSDI claim is denied, don’t give up. Many claims are denied at first, but you have the option to appeal the decision and reapply. Seek legal assistance if you're unsure how to proceed.


How to manage your SSDI application in Nebraska

Managing your SSDI application carefully can make a big difference in the outcome. Here are a few tips to stay on track:



  • Stay Organized – Keep copies of all your medical records, application forms, and communication with the SSA. This will help ensure nothing is overlooked.
  • Stay Updated – Regularly check the status of your claim to ensure there are no issues or delays in the process.
